#117041 Hex Color Code

#117041

The Hexadecimal Color #117041 is a contrast shade of Forest Green. #117041 RGB value is rgb(17, 112, 65). RGB Color Model of #117041 consists of 6% red, 43% green and 25% blue. HSL color Mode of #117041 has 150°(degrees) Hue, 74% Saturation and 25% Lightness. #117041 color has an wavelength of 525.55556n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#117041 is #339966.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#117041 is #174. The Closest Color to #117041 is #228B22. Official Name of #117041 Hex Code is Jewel.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#117041 is 85 Cyan 0 Magenta 42 Yellow 56 Black and #117041 CMY is 85, 0, 42.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#117041 is hsl(150,74,25,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(150, 85, 44).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#117041 is 6.98, 12.09, 6.97.
Hex8 Value of #117041 is #117041FF. Decimal Value of #117041 is 1142849 and Octal Value of #117041 is 4270101. Binary Value of #117041 is 10001, 1110000, 1000001 and Android of #117041 is 4279332929 / 0xff117041.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#117041 is 0.268, 0.464, 0.464 and YIQ Color Space of #117041 is 78.237, -41.5094, -34.7189.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#117041 is 9.18, 15.65, 7.04.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#117041 is 41.36, -37.85, 18.89.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#117041 is 41.36, -34.63, 27.78.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#117041 is 41.36, 42.3, 153.48. Hunter Lab variable of #117041 is 34.77, -25.02, 12.45.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#117041

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
